What are the Best Investment Strategies for Beginners in 2024? A Comprehensive Guide to Building a Successful Portfolio

  1. Start with a solid foundation: Understand your financial goals and risk tolerance.
  2. Focus on diversification: Spread your investments across different asset classes.
  3. Consider low-cost index funds: These provide broad market exposure with minimal fees.
  4. Stay consistent: Regularly contribute to your investments and avoid emotional decision-making.
  5. Seek professional advice: Consider consulting with a financial advisor for personalized guidance.

Understanding Your Financial Goals and Risk Tolerance

Before diving into investing, it's crucial to have a clear understanding of your financial objectives and how much risk you are comfortable with. This will help shape your investment strategy and asset allocation.

Diversifying Your Investments

Diversification is key to managing risk in your portfolio. By spreading your investments across various asset classes such as stocks, bonds, and real estate, you can reduce the impact of any single investment's performance on your overall portfolio.

Consider Low-Cost Index Funds

Index funds are a popular choice for beginners due to their low fees and broad market exposure. These funds track a specific market index, such as the S&P 500, and offer a simple way to gain diversified exposure to the stock market.

Consistent Contributions and Avoiding Emotional Decision-Making

Consistency is key to long-term investing success. By regularly contributing to your investments, you can benefit from dollar-cost averaging and avoid trying to time the market. Additionally, it's important to make investment decisions based on research and analysis rather than emotions.

Seeking Professional Advice

For those new to investing, seeking guidance from a financial advisor can provide valuable insights and personalized recommendations. A professional can help tailor an investment strategy to your specific financial situation and goals.
